Robert Half are recruiting for a Qualified Accountant to join a global Energy & Infrastructure business as Senior Accountant, based in Central London. This is a high-impact, hybrid role offering exposure to front-office traders and senior leadership, combining technical accounting responsibilities with business partnering and commercial insight. The ideal candidate will bring a strong grounding in financial and management accounting, along with experience in IFRS 9, IFRS 15, and IFRS 16. The business trades power, gas, and environmental certificates, using a range of derivatives including forwards, futures, swaps, and options. The UK platform is fully integrated into a global trading business, providing a unique opportunity to combine technical accounting with commercial exposure.
About the Position
Reporting directly to the Head of Finance, you will play a pivotal role within the Finance team, acting as a bridge between finance and the front office. Your responsibilities will include:
- Leading and supporting the budgeting process in collaboration with Traders, Business Developers, and senior stakeholders.
- Translating commercial activity into appropriate accounting treatment, including applying IFRS 9, IFRS 15, IFRS 16, and other relevant standards for new contracts and trading transactions.
- Producing monthly management accounts and high-quality reporting packs, including detailed variance analysis, KPIs, and commentary for the business.
- Conducting profitability analysis, cost reviews, and supporting forecasting and financial planning processes.
- Managing OPEX accounting, accrual approvals, and supporting audit and compliance activities.
- Ensuring accurate booking of derivative transactions and maintaining adherence to accounting policies.
- Designing and maintaining complex Excel-based reports to support operational and commercial decision-making.
What We’re Looking For
- Minimum of 7 years’ experience in finance roles, within the energy industry; prior experience within the energy industry is essential.
- Qualified accountant (ACA, ACCA, CIMA, or equivalent) with strong technical knowledge of IFRS 9, IFRS 15, and IFRS 16.
- Strong foundation in both financial and management accounting, with hands-on experience in month-end close, statutory reporting, and commercial analysis.
- Ability to interpret complex contracts and apply accounting standards to derivatives, PPAs, or traded instruments.
- Proven experience in business partnering, working closely with commercial teams and front-office stakeholders.
- Advanced Excel and data analysis skills.
- Confident communicator, proactive, and able to manage multiple priorities in a fast-paced environment.
